What is Storm Floris? A Deep Dive into its Formation and Characteristics
So, what exactly is Storm Floris? To really get our heads around it, we need to look at the science behind storm formation. In simple terms, storms are born out of atmospheric disturbances – think of clashes between warm and cold air masses, fueled by the energy of the sun and the Earth's rotation. Storm Floris, like other European windstorms, likely developed as an extratropical cyclone, a type of storm system that forms in mid-latitudes. These cyclones are characterized by their low-pressure centers and rotating wind patterns. The specific characteristics of Storm Floris, such as its intensity, trajectory, and size, would have been influenced by a complex interplay of meteorological factors. These factors can include the sea surface temperature, upper-level wind patterns, and the overall atmospheric conditions over the North Atlantic. Understanding these dynamics is crucial to predicting and preparing for future storms. The intensity of a storm is typically measured by its wind speeds and the central pressure. Lower central pressure often indicates a stronger storm. But it's not just about the numbers; the impact of a storm depends on a range of factors, including the angle at which it hits the coastline, the timing of high tide, and the vulnerability of the affected areas. Preparing for the Next Storm: Scotland's Strategies and Resilience
Okay, so we've seen the potential devastation that storms like Storm Floris can bring. The big question is, what can be done to prepare for the next one? Scotland, like other countries facing similar threats, has implemented a range of strategies to build resilience against severe weather events. This includes everything from sophisticated weather forecasting systems to improved infrastructure and community-level preparedness plans. Accurate weather forecasts are crucial, as they provide early warnings that allow people to take precautions. The Met Office, the UK's national weather service, plays a vital role in monitoring weather patterns and issuing alerts for impending storms. These warnings are disseminated through various channels, including television, radio, and online platforms, allowing individuals and businesses to stay informed. But it's not just about knowing a storm is coming; it's about being prepared. This means having emergency kits ready, knowing evacuation routes, and understanding how to protect your property. Community resilience is also key. Local emergency services, community groups, and individual citizens all have a part to play in preparing for and responding to storms. We'll explore some of the innovative approaches being used in Scotland to enhance resilience, such as nature-based solutions that use natural features like wetlands and forests to mitigate flooding. We'll also discuss the importance of building codes and infrastructure standards that can withstand severe weather. The Future of Storms in Scotland: Climate Change and Long-Term Trends
Let's talk about the future, guys. What does the future hold for storms in Scotland, especially in the context of climate change? This is a big question, and the answer is complex, but it's something we need to consider seriously. Climate change is expected to have a significant impact on weather patterns around the world, and Scotland is no exception. While it's difficult to say definitively whether climate change is directly responsible for any single storm, the overall trend suggests that we may see more frequent and intense extreme weather events in the future. Warmer temperatures can lead to more energy in the atmosphere, which can fuel stronger storms. Changes in sea levels can exacerbate coastal flooding, and altered rainfall patterns can increase the risk of both droughts and floods. To understand the long-term trends, scientists use climate models to project how weather patterns may change over time. These models take into account a variety of factors, including greenhouse gas emissions, sea surface temperatures, and atmospheric circulation patterns. While there is still some uncertainty in these projections, the overall message is clear: we need to be prepared for a future where extreme weather events like Storm Floris may become more common. This means investing in infrastructure that can withstand these events, developing effective adaptation strategies, and, crucially, taking action to reduce greenhouse gas emissions.
